Robotic surgery isn’t simply a matter of a robot operating independently. It’s a surgeon-controlled system. The surgeon sits at a console, viewing a high-definition, 3D image of the surgical site. They manipulate robotic arms equipped with specialized instruments, translating their hand movements into precise, scaled-down actions within the patient’s body. This provides enhanced dexterity, visualization, and control compared to traditional laparoscopic surgery. You should know that the surgeon maintains complete control throughout the entire procedure.

What are the Key Benefits of Robotic Surgery?
You’ll discover a multitude of advantages when considering robotic surgery. Perhaps the most significant is enhanced precision. The robotic system minimizes tremors and allows for movements that are impossible for the human hand alone. This is particularly beneficial in delicate procedures like prostatectomies or mitral valve repairs. The improved dexterity also allows surgeons to access hard-to-reach areas with greater ease.
Another crucial benefit is minimally invasive surgery. Smaller incisions lead to less pain, reduced blood loss, and a lower risk of infection. You’ll likely experience a shorter hospital stay and a quicker return to your daily activities. This is a significant improvement over traditional open surgery, which often requires extensive recovery periods.
Improved visualization is also a key advantage. The high-definition, 3D imaging system provides surgeons with a clearer and more detailed view of the surgical site. This allows for greater accuracy and reduces the risk of damaging surrounding tissues. You can expect a more thorough and precise operation thanks to this enhanced visual clarity.
Finally, robotic surgery often results in reduced scarring. The smaller incisions leave minimal visible scars, which can be a significant cosmetic benefit for patients. This can also improve the overall healing process and reduce the risk of long-term complications. Aesthetic considerations are often important to patients, and robotic surgery can offer a more favorable cosmetic outcome.
Understanding the Potential Risks of Robotic Surgery
While robotic surgery offers numerous benefits, it’s essential to be aware of the potential risks. Like any surgical procedure, there’s a risk of infection, bleeding, and blood clots. However, the minimally invasive nature of robotic surgery often reduces these risks compared to traditional open surgery. You should discuss these risks with your surgeon to understand your individual risk factors.
Nerve damage is another potential complication, although it’s relatively rare. The robotic instruments can sometimes cause injury to nearby nerves, leading to pain, numbness, or weakness. Your surgeon will take precautions to minimize this risk, but it’s important to be aware of the possibility. “While robotic surgery aims for precision, unforeseen complications can still occur, highlighting the importance of a skilled surgical team.”
System malfunction is a rare but serious risk. Although robotic systems are rigorously tested and maintained, there’s always a possibility of a mechanical failure during surgery. In such cases, the surgeon is trained to quickly revert to traditional surgical techniques. You should feel confident that your surgical team is prepared to handle any unexpected events.
Conversion to open surgery may be necessary in some cases. If the surgeon encounters unexpected difficulties during the robotic procedure, they may need to convert to traditional open surgery to ensure the best possible outcome. This is not a failure of the robotic system, but rather a recognition that open surgery may be the most appropriate approach in certain situations.
What Does Robotic Surgery Recovery Involve?
Your recovery experience will depend on the specific procedure you undergo, but generally, robotic surgery recovery is faster and less painful than traditional open surgery recovery. You can expect to spend less time in the hospital and return to your normal activities sooner. However, it’s crucial to follow your surgeon’s instructions carefully to ensure a smooth and successful recovery.
Pain management is an important part of the recovery process. Your surgeon will prescribe pain medication to help manage any discomfort you may experience. It’s important to take the medication as directed and to communicate with your surgeon if your pain is not adequately controlled. You’ll likely find that the pain is less severe than with traditional surgery.
Physical therapy may be recommended to help you regain strength and mobility. A physical therapist will develop a customized exercise program to help you rebuild your muscles and improve your range of motion. You should follow the therapist’s instructions diligently to maximize your recovery. Consistent participation in physical therapy is key to achieving optimal results.
Wound care is essential to prevent infection. You’ll need to keep the incision sites clean and dry and follow your surgeon’s instructions for dressing changes. Be sure to watch for any signs of infection, such as redness, swelling, or pus, and report them to your surgeon immediately. Proper wound care is crucial for a successful recovery.
Robotic Surgery vs. Traditional Open Surgery: A Detailed Comparison
To better understand the advantages of robotic surgery, let’s compare it to traditional open surgery. The following table highlights the key differences:
| Feature | Robotic Surgery | Traditional Open Surgery |
|---|---|---|
| Incision Size | Small (typically a few centimeters) | Large (several inches) |
| Pain | Less | More |
| Blood Loss | Reduced | Greater |
| Hospital Stay | Shorter | Longer |
| Recovery Time | Faster | Slower |
| Scarring | Minimal | Significant |
| Precision | Enhanced | Standard |

What Procedures are Commonly Performed with Robotic Surgery?
Robotic surgery is now used in a wide range of specialties, including: urology (prostatectomy, nephrectomy), gynecology (hysterectomy, myomectomy), cardiac surgery (mitral valve repair, coronary artery bypass grafting), general surgery (gallbladder removal, hernia repair), and head and neck surgery. The applications of robotic surgery are continually expanding as the technology evolves. You’ll find that more and more procedures are becoming available using this innovative approach.

The Cost of Robotic Surgery: What Factors Influence Price?
The cost of robotic surgery can vary significantly depending on several factors. These include the complexity of the procedure, the hospital where it’s performed, and the surgeon’s fees. The cost of the robotic system itself also contributes to the overall expense. You should discuss the cost of the procedure with your surgeon and your insurance provider to understand your financial responsibility. It’s important to weigh the initial cost against the potential long-term benefits, such as reduced hospital stays and fewer complications.
